Moderate Taut describes something that is stretched or pulled tight, often referring to a state of tension or strain. Clear All
4 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Taut'
The skin on the drum was taut, producing a sharp beat.
The soldier's taut muscles indicated readiness for action.
The suspense in the room made the atmosphere taut with anticipation.
The highwire artist's body remained taut throughout the performance.
